Transaction 325832c7fca36e21c8a822a99449b57899476fc512f1771099db56ecb41a3708
2 Input
2 Outputs
- 325832c7fca36e21c8a822a99449b57899476fc512f1771099db56ecb41a3708:0
- 325832c7fca36e21c8a822a99449b57899476fc512f1771099db56ecb41a3708:1
value 10000000
address 31mXi8F7Vp7RcEt1YSSsHCCG9wjFi9oSvg
value 21612318
address 1FN64jcfy4eqUwxFYXJn3gdoda1iQmkSFT